CVE-2026-41493: yard: Possible arbitrary path traversal and file access via yard server

April 17, 2026 (updated April 27, 2026)

A path traversal vulnerability was discovered in YARD <= 0.9.41 when using yard server to serve documentation. This bug would allow unsanitized HTTP requests to access arbitrary files on the machine of a yard server host under certain conditions.

The original patch in GHSA-xfhh-rx56-rxcr was incorrectly applied.

Affected versions

All versions before 0.9.42

Fixed versions

  • 0.9.42

Solution

Upgrade to version 0.9.42 or above.

Impact 5.3 MEDIUM

C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:N/A:N

Learn more about CVSS

Weakness

  • CWE-22: Improper Limitation of a Pathname to a Restricted Directory ('Path Traversal')
